Output 61e517afb26c6c29fe5093e91afd56bf43c74ebdb52ba15ab4979e78d744c7e6:35

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26a1aca5e91dee1e383d1b0076401eb7d9cae6d OP_EQUAL
address
3NLBkBGKTVy5wEXNr3n6vbHXNmh1YUeXeJ
transaction
61e517afb26c6c29fe5093e91afd56bf43c74ebdb52ba15ab4979e78d744c7e6
confirmations
190111
spent
true